Conceptual design of a coal-fired MHD retrofit plant
Westinghouse Advanced Energy Systems (WAES), through Contract No. DE-AC22-87PC79668 funded by US DOE/PETC, is conducting a conceptual design study to evaluate a coal fired MHD retrofit of a utility plant of sufficient size to demonstrate the technical and future economic viability of an MHD system operating within an electric utility environment. The utility plant considered in this study is the Scholz Generating Station which is owned and operated by Gulf Power Company, a member of the Southern Company. In the earlier tasks of this study, the Westinghouse design team was comprised of the following members: Southern Electric International (the architectural engineering arm of the Southern Company), University of Tennessee Space Institute (UTSI), Seitec, Inc., HMJ Corporation, STD Research Corp, and the Westinghouse Science Center. A previous contract deliverable report documented the efforts of this team over the period of performance from October 1987 through April 1989. The objective of this project is to prepare a site-specific conceptual design of a coal-fired magnetohydrodynamic (MHD) system for retrofit to the Scholz Generating Station, Sneads, Florida.
